WebThe eagerly awaited decision in the case of Voller was handed down by the High Court of Australia on 8 September 2024 following a hearing on 18 May 2024. The decision has far-reaching consequences and has prompted a significant review by media organisations of its activities and operations and has also prompted calls for legislative change.
